Nice and sturdy but not too heavy to transport. Great for walking in the yard or uneven terrain. We have not used it in sand so can’t comment. But the size of the wheels would make it easier I would say than the thin wheel other walker my MIL tried to use at the beach. We had to just carry it to the shore line, I would say this might actually work in the beach sand and shore line . It does very well in the yard and in parking lot with uneven surfaces the other “traditional “ walker would get stuck on a rock,ugh… it was only made for smooth even surfaces. This one also maneuvers much much easier,she no longer runs into furniture or walls . For any active seniors or adults with a functional disability I would recommend. This walker also allowed her to shop with us at the outlet malls when she got tired she just sat down, and it carried her stuff in it built in basket. We added a drink holder and bought a clip on rechargeable fan so she was comfortable no matter where she went . She loves it for the ball field, she can go watch her great-grandchildren play soccer and baseball! I’m planning on putting some spinner lights on the wheels and decorate it for Halloween so she can go trick or treating this year LOL. SHE Loves it, we love it bc it help her keep her independence and active

My 94 year old mom loves this one for outdoor activities. The big wheels make it stable in rough areas. Mom loves the breaks that lock it in place and loves the seat when she needs a break. She keeps chickens and uses it to walk to and from the chicken coop. She loves the basket in the front for her egg bucket.
